Strohmenger, Jean G., Age: 87, Rumson

Jean G. Strohmenger, 87, of Rumson, passed away on Friday, July 22. She was born in Elizabeth to the late Emil F. Geile and Edna (Pries). She has lived in Rumson since 1952. Jean graduated from the Pratt Institute, New York, and the Red Bank Business Institute. Jean worked for many years as a legal secretary for Parsons and Labreque in Red Bank.

She was a member of Rumson Presbyterian Church, a past member of the Ladies Auxiliary Oceanic Fire Department and also a member of Rumson Senior Citizens.

Jean was predeceased by her husband William in 2008 and her brother Billy Geile. She is survived by four sons, William and his wife Patricia of Lewes, Delaware, Robert and his wife Lorraine of West Long Branch, Thomas and his wife Lynn of Yorba Linda, California, and John and his wife Catherine of Howell; six loving grandchildren, Robert, Katherine, Heather, William, J.D. and Joseph; four beautiful great-grandchildren; and a sister, Joan Phillips of Colts Neck.
